Job Description

Compliance Officer (San Francisco, CA): Our client, a growing alternative asset manager with over $10B AUM, is seeking a senior compliance officer to join their team. This person will work alongside the GC/CCO touching US and international compliance.

Highlights:

  • Opportunity to join a growing firm in a newly created capacity working alongside a talented GC/CCO as the first fully dedicated compliance hire
  • Firm encourages an open door policy and values kind, smart, collaborative people
  • Highly visible and interactive role across teams and all levels internally
  • Hybrid work (4 days in) and excellent work/life balance, benefits, and compensation

Responsibilities:

  • Conduct general compliance reviews including: personal securities transaction reviews, investment restriction reviews; vendor management reviews, social media and political contributions testing
  • Design and implement compliance policies, procedures and related controls and testing protocols
  • Prepare regulatory filings (i.e. ADV, Form 13F, Form PF)
  • Review, edit and update all marketing materials and decks
  • Support IR on all compliance matters relating to Client/LP inquiries
  • Handle special projects and/or other duties as assigned by CCO and Management
  • Gift and entertainment reviews (Conduct reviews on reported gifts and entertainment requests to confirm consistency with global policies and regulatory requirements)
  • Monitors employee trading to safeguard the firm and to prevent employees from trading on, or the appearance of trading on, material non-public information and liaise with all employees relating to their personal trades

Qualifications:

  • Minimum 5 years of alternative asset compliance experience
  • Bachelor's Degree and strong educational background; JD is a strong plus, but not required
  • High level of self-motivation and interpersonal skills
  • High level of attention to detail
  • Experience mentoring / working alongside junior resources
